Maple Leaf Elementary School is a State/Public serving elementary age pupils, located in Garfield Heights, Cuyahoga County. The school has 449 pupils enrolled. It is part of the Garfield Heights City Schools school district. It serves grades Kโ5 in a suburban setting. The school employs 24 full-time-equivalent teachers, a student-teacher ratio of 18.7:1. 21% of students are proficient in reading. 8% are proficient in maths. Maple Leaf Elementary School enrolls 449 students across grades Kโ5. The student body is 51% male and 49% female. A teaching staff of 24 full-time-equivalent teachers supports the school, giving a student-teacher ratio of 18.7:1.
By race and ethnicity, the student body is 77% Black or African American, 10% Two or more races and 8.7% White.
| Race / ethnicity | Students | Share |
|---|---|---|
| Black or African American | 344 | 77% |
| Two or more races | 45 | 10% |
| White | 39 | 8.7% |
| Hispanic or Latino | 18 | 4% |
| Asian | 2 | <1% |
| American Indian or Alaska Native | 1 | <1% |
Source: NCES Common Core of Data.

Maple Leaf Elementary School is one of 5 schools in Garfield Heights City Schools, based in Garfield Heights, Ohio. The district serves 2,581 students district-wide and employs 200 full-time-equivalent teachers. With 449 students, Maple Leaf Elementary School is close to the district average of about 516 students per school.
